The pickguard bracket is a small piece with a visible job: it holds the guard in the right place and, on a vintage-correct build, it has to look the part while doing it. Ours is built to original late-1950s specification — accurate dimensions, correct shape, and a gold finish matched to the warm tone of period hardware.

It's a complete assembly, not just the bracket. Each one includes the mounting screw, the nut, and the locking washer — everything needed to install it properly and keep it secure.

You also choose the screw to match your build: Phillips or slotted. Slotted is the correct choice for the earliest instruments; Phillips suits later-spec and Historic Reissue builds. Either way, the detail is right for the guitar you're working on.

Choose NOS for a clean, just-installed look, or Aged for a well-loved, road-worn character. And the aging here isn't a generic tumble or a chemical dip — it's done by hand in the Historic Makeovers shop, the same aging that goes onto the instruments our clients trust us with. Every aged piece is treated individually, so each one carries slight variations that make it its own.

    Kim, a legend in the vintage guitar world, has spent over 50 years restoring, buying, and selling classic instruments, especially 1950s Les Pauls.
    His passion led to founding Retrospec and later Historic Makeovers®, dedicated to making modern guitars look, feel, and sound vintage.
    Nearly two decades on, his craftsmanship and innovation continue to set the standard in vintage-style restoration.
